Bitcoin Pizza Day: A Slice of Crypto History

Every year on May 22nd, the global crypto community celebrates Bitcoin Pizza Day, marking a pivotal moment in the history of cryptocurrency. On this day in 2010, Laszlo Hanyecz, a programmer from Florida, made the first documented real-world purchase using Bitcoin. He paid 10,000 BTC for two Papa John's pizzas—worth about $41 at the time. Today, that amount of Bitcoin would be worth millions, making it one of the most expensive meals in history.

This event is more than just a quirky anecdote. It symbolizes the beginning of Bitcoin’s journey from a niche digital currency to a global financial phenomenon. Bitcoin Pizza Day is now commemorated by crypto enthusiasts worldwide with memes, meetups, pizza parties, and promotional events, often organized by major exchanges like Binance.

Beyond the celebration, the day serves as a reminder of how far the crypto industry has come—and how early adoption can sometimes mean big risk or big reward. It's also a testament to the vision of a decentralized economy where digital assets are used in everyday life.
